Numerical simulations of groundwater flow and solute transport in beaches have rapidly evolved over the last three decades accounting for tidal hydraulics and for seaward boundary condition. Most of these studies focused on tide-induced variation of groundwater hydraulic head but with a constant surface water salinity on the seaward boundary. In reality, salinity in tidal creeks varies in response to the combined influences of saline tides from downstream estuary and freshwater flow from upstream river. Existing observations and reports indicated that the variations of salinity in tidal creek are typically corresponding with its water level fluctuations, referring to "tidal salinity fluctuations". The primary goal of this project is to explore the influences of tidal level and salinity fluctuations in estuary on the submarine groundwater discharge (SGD) and solute transport in shallow beaches with sloped intertidal zone. Field study in typical intertidal zone of Changjiang River estuary, laboratory experiments and numerical modelling techniques will be employed for this propose. Sensitivity analyses will be conducted to investigate the effects of seepage face, inland freshwater recharge, and beach permeability on the distribution of salt plumes (freshwater-saltwater interface/mixing zone) in the beach and the SGD across the beach-sea interface subjected to the tidal level and salinity fluctuations. Such an improved understanding of the beach groundwater hydrodynamics is desired for addressing the coastal exigent problems (e.g., seawater intrusion, shoreline contamination), and for better strategies to manage similar coastal tidal beaches and the adjacent marine environment.
河口海滩是陆地-海洋交界带的中心区域,是海水(咸水)和地下水(淡水)相互作用和转化的重要场所。近30年来,许多学者对潮汐水位变化作用下的海滩地下水-地表水交互过程进行了广泛研究,但极少关注潮汐引起的河口水域盐度变化(指感潮河地表水盐度随潮汐周期性变化的现象)对海滩地下水动力过程的影响。而盐度在维持海滩生物多样性等方面发挥着重要作用。本项目将以长江河口海滩为研究对象,结合现场原型实验及其监测、数学模型和数值模拟等综合技术手段,系统定量地研究潮汐水位和盐度变化耦合条件下海滩中地下水流和盐分运移的规律。通过敏感性分析,综合考虑该条件下海滩地表渗出面、非均质性等因素对海滩地下水-地表水交换率、海底地下水排泄量(SGD)和海滩中盐度分布(咸淡水混合带/交界面)的影响。该项目将有助于阐明长江河口海滩的海水入侵、咸淡水混合等复杂地下水动力过程,为该类河口海滩生态环境的保护和管理提供理论依据和技术支撑。
本项目以长江河口海滩为研究对象,结合现场原型实验及其监测、数学模型和数值模拟等综合技术手段,系统定量地研究潮汐水位和盐度变化耦合条件下海滩中地下水流和盐分运移的规律。项目获取了10口观测井连续一个月的水位、盐度和温度的监测数据。同时获取了6个长期监测井连续一年的水位、盐度和温度的监测数据。通过分析监测数据和潮间带水文地质参数,提出了上部淤泥层-下部含砂层的双层含水层概念模型,构建了相应的数值模型;现场观测结果与数值模拟结果表明,地表水在高潮(涨潮)期间由高潮线附近渗入含水层,低潮期间地下水从低潮带渗出地表。地表水-地下水的这一运动特征与潮间带的植被分带一致,并且潮汐盐度周期性变化有利于海底地下淡水排泄。通过敏感性分析,综合考虑该条件下海滩地表渗出面、非均质性等因素对海滩地下水-地表水交换率、海底地下水排泄量(SGD)和海滩中盐度分布(咸淡水混合带/交界面)的影响。该项目研究成果有助于阐明长江河口海滩的海水入侵、咸淡水混合等复杂地下水动力过程,为该类河口海滩生态环境的保护和管理提供理论依据和技术支撑。
